The Importance of Realistic Before-and-After Expectations
Understanding Before-and-After Photos
Before-and-after photos are valuable tools, but they should be viewed with realistic expectations. Every patient is unique, and results vary based on anatomy and individual healing.
How to Evaluate Photos
Look for patients with a similar body type and concerns to yours. Pay attention to lighting, angles, and the time elapsed since surgery. Reputable clinics show consistent, unedited results rather than cherry-picked outcomes.
Setting Your Own Expectations
Use photos as a reference, not a guarantee. An honest discussion with your surgeon about what is achievable for your unique body is the best way to set realistic expectations.
